Crowne Plaza Glasgow

Crowne Plaza tower
View Crowne Plaza Glasgow on the map

Location

Pacific Quay & SECC, SECC

Address

Congress Road , Glasgow, G3 8QT

Type

Current

Description

QMH Ltd  carried out the upgrading and refurbishment of the existing hotel to create the 283-bedroomed Crowne Plaza Glasgow, adjacent to the SECC.

During 2006, all bedrooms, public areas including the restaurant and bar, and the hotel’s 15 meeting and conference rooms were refurbished. A Club Lounge was also added on the 15th floor with stunning Clyde views.

The hotel’s riverside restaurant, ONE, offers fashionable food in a contemporary setting whilst the Quarterdeck Bar provides a relaxed area to enjoy lunch or take advantage of the hotel’s wi-fi internet access.

The hotel also has full leisure club facilities, day spa and extensive on site car parking.

 

Cost

This is a multi-million pound refurbishment.

Current status

The refurbishment was completed in autumn 2006 and the hotel is open.

Clyde Waterfront is a strategic partnership comprising the Scottish Government, Scottish Enterprise, Glasgow City, Renfrewshire and West Dunbartonshire Councils. Its purpose is to promote the economic, social and environmental regeneration of 13 miles of the River Clyde from Glasgow city centre to Dumbarton.
